DPR Construction is seeking a Field Engineer with up to 2 years of commercial construction experience.
Responsibilities- Assisting and supporting field work under the direction of the Project Superintendents and Assistant Superintendents.
- Coordinate working and shop drawings.
- Coordinate the delivery, coding and purchasing of project materials.
- Assist in the preparation and subsequent monitoring/updating of the project schedule
- Assist in generating three-week look- ahead schedules
- Weekly Work Plan and Production Planning. - Organize and conduct subcontractor meetings and produce meeting minutes (ideally in CMIC).
- Assist in the project’s RFI & Submittal process.
- Assist in the completion of project close‑out activities, including developing/completing items from corrective action lists and punch lists.
- Coordinate work‑in‑place quantities and DPR labor.
- Directs Company foreman and laborers at the discretion of the Project Superintendent.
- Has internal contact with:
Project Management Staff;
To coordinate shop drawings, expedite materials and coordinate with assigned duties. - Has external contact with:
Subcontractors and Vendors;
To ensure the timely delivery of required materials, proper installation of same, and adherence to schedule and safety requirements. Architects and Consultants;
To obtain information regarding changes and clarification of drawings. Building Officials;
To assure that necessary inspections are coordinated in a timely manner. - Attend and participate actively in Superintendent Peer Group Meetings.
- Work with the Safety Coordinator to execute safety audits on a regular basis.
- Possess independent judgment, creativity, initiative, and ability to apply knowledge and experience to resolve problems, compose correspondence and technical reports, and accomplish goals where established procedures may not be specific.
- Ability to read basic blueprints and shop drawings.
- Develop skills around excavation safety and fall protection.
- Thorough understanding of plans, specifications and subcontractor scopes.
- Learn Total Station layout and control and operate in that capacity for a minimum 4 months in the field.
- Competent user of BIM modeling and ability to get obtain specific detail in the building through the model.
- Working knowledge of P6 software and Our Plan.
- Develop presentation and communication skills.
- General knowledge of the project Monthly Status Reports (MSR).
- Read and understand DPR’s labor cost reports (LCR).
- Ability to perform field take‑offs; order, receive, return, and track equipment and material.
- Understanding of crane safety and rigging competency.
- Knowledge of rigging hand signals.
- Demonstrate excellent interpersonal skills and ability to deal with diverse types of people in a tactful, professional, and effective manner.
- Ability to deal with pressures of deadlines, heavy workloads, demanding people, and constant interruptions.
